Bizdome Incubation Council

Bizdome Incubation Council is an incubator based in India that supports early-stage startups by providing resources, mentorship, and access to funding opportunities.

What Incubator means

An incubator is a support environment for turning a nascent idea or early company into a startup that is more ready for customers, funding, or an accelerator.
